A Little Note...

Today we are sharing a sweet little note card created by Tatiana. This cute little scene filled with mice and flowers is perfect for sending a cheerful spring wish to a friend. 

She started out by stamping and coloring the duo of mice holding flowers from our Garden Mice Stamp Set. She colored the mice in neutral grays and then added bright pops of orange and purple for the big blooms. She also added highlights with a white gel pen for added detail. She cut the two images out using the coordinating Garden Mice Die Set

Mouse Themed Note Card by Tatiana Trafimovich | Garden Mice Stamp Set, Frames & Tags Die Set, Clouds Stencil and Hills & Grass Stencil by Newton's Nook Designs #newtonsnook #handmade

For her card, she created a fun background scene onto a white card base. She added green grass using our Hills & Grass Stencil along the bottom and then added blue ink for a sky along the top. She then added a few clouds into the sky using our Cloudy Sky Stencil with a bit of white pigment ink. This is such a fun and easy way to make a background scene. 

Next, she cut out the fun stitched frame using our Frames & Tags Die Set. She then arranged the frame over the background and tucked the mice into it on opposite sides. Isn't it cute how the mouse is peeking down from the top corner? She added the sentiment "just a little note..." from the Garden Mice Stamp Set, embossed in white onto a purple banner. She also added a few epoxy dots in orange and purple for a finishing detail.
